Brazil Appeals Court Holds Pool Licence Offer Meets FRAND Obligation In Panasonic v HMD
The Rio de Janeiro Court of Appeals has issued a landmark ruling in a standard essential patent dispute between Panasonic and HMD, establishing that offering only a pool license can satisfy FRAND obligations under Brazilian law. The decision marks a significant development in Brazil's growing role as a venue for SEP licensing disputes and addresses questions about what constitutes good faith licensing behavior.

Brazil Revises Its Patent Examination Guidelines For New Use Inventions: Key Changes And Remaining Challenges
Brazil's patent office has revised its examination guidelines for new use inventions in chemistry, particularly medical uses, following extensive stakeholder consultation. The updated rules now permit post-filing data under certain conditions while maintaining restrictions on dosage regimen and patient group claims, creating a mixed landscape for pharmaceutical patent protection in Latin America's largest market.

BRPTO Changes Rules For High-Renown Applications
The Brazilian Patent and Trademark Office has introduced new rules allowing trademark owners to consolidate multiple registrations under a single high-renown status application. This procedural change, effective immediately through Normative Ordinance #68/2026, enables special protection across different classes of goods and services. The amendment responds to stakeholder feedback and aims to streamline the process for owners of widely recognized brands operating in diverse market segments.
